When you love what you do, striving for excellence becomes a labor of love. In the high-paced worlds of business and sports, it’s no secret that overexertion is a common enemy. The chase for excellence, while commendable, can sometimes blur the lines between passion and obsession, leading to burnout. Both executives and athletes know the perils of pushing too hard, and as diverse as their worlds might seem, their strategies to address overexertion share striking similarities. Recognizing the Signs of Burnout Physical Symptoms: For athletes, overtraining might manifest as prolonged muscle soreness, frequent injuries, and constant fatigue. Executives, though less physically active, aren’t exempt from physical signs. Persistent headaches, sleep disturbances, and a weakened immune system can indicate that they're overworking. Mental and Emotional Signs: Both groups might also experience mental fatigue, irritability, loss of motivation, concentration difficulties, and feelings of ineffectiveness. Recognizing these signs early can make a significant difference. In the quest for peak performance, the worlds of sports and business have much more in common than one might think.
